Registered Nursing at Salish Kootenai College

If you plan to study Registered Nursing, consider the program at Salish Kootenai College. The following information will help you decide if it is a good fit for you.

Salish Kootenai College sits in Pablo, MT.

During the most recent reporting year, 21 registered nursing graduations were recorded at Salish Kootenai College.

Online Class Availability at Salish Kootenai College

Distance learning is available at Salish Kootenai College. Of 671 students, 27 (4%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 332 (49%) took at least some classes online.

Registered Nursing Bachelor’s Program at Salish Kootenai College

Among the 21 bachelor’s registered nursing graduates at Salish Kootenai College, 95% were women (20) and 5% were men (1).

Salish Kootenai College gender breakdown of Registered Nursing Bachelor's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Registered Nursing bachelor’s degree recipients at Salish Kootenai College.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 14
American Indian / Alaska Native 7
Racial-ethnic diversity of Registered Nursing majors at Salish Kootenai College

Racial-ethnic minorities make up 33% of Registered Nursing bachelor’s degree recipients at Salish Kootenai College, below the national average of 43%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
